UPS workers gathered outside the company's Worldport air hub in Louisville Wednesday morning to "practice" picketing as the Teamsters union and the company enter crunch time in their high-profile contract talks.
The Atlanta-based company said the start of “business continuity training” is not a signal that negotiations with the Teamsters are less likely to result in an agreement on a new, five-year labor contract.
